A reputable catering company is seeking a talented Head Chef to lead operations at a prestigious Cambridge site. You will manage a busy kitchen serving up to 400 covers daily while providing high-quality hospitality for events.

The ideal candidate will have contract catering experience, strong team management skills, and a passion for food quality.

The role offers a Monday to Friday schedule with no weekend shifts, ensuring a great work-life balance.

How to prepare for a job interview at Chartwells Independent

Know Your Numbers

As a Head Chef, you'll be managing a busy kitchen serving up to 400 covers daily. Brush up on your knowledge of food costs, portion control, and kitchen efficiency metrics. Being able to discuss how you’ve optimised these in past roles will impress the interviewers.

Showcase Your Leadership Style

Strong team management skills are crucial for this role. Prepare examples of how you've successfully led a kitchen team, resolved conflicts, or trained new staff. Highlighting your leadership style will demonstrate that you can maintain a positive work environment.

Passion for Quality

This company values high-quality hospitality and food. Be ready to talk about your passion for food quality and how you ensure it in your kitchen. Share specific dishes or events where you went above and beyond to deliver exceptional culinary experiences.
